How to unpin a Snapchat chat on iPhone
On iPhone, unpinning is simple and can be done directly from the chat screen. Here’s how to do it:
- Open Snapchat and swipe right to access the Chats screen.
- Locate the pinned chat you want to unpin. Pinned conversations typically have a small pin icon next to the contact name.
- Tap and hold the pinned chat until a context menu appears. If your device uses 3D Touch or Haptic Touch, you may need to press a bit longer.
- From the menu, select Unpin Chat (or a similar option like Unpin or Unpin from Top depending on your version).
- The chat will return to the normal position in your chat list, ordered by the latest activity.
If you don’t see the Unpin option, try updating the app or restarting Snapchat. In rare cases, a temporary glitch can hide certain options. After the unpin action, you should notice the chat no longer sits at the top, making room for other conversations to take priority.
How to unpin a Snapchat chat on Android
Android users may see slight variations in the menu wording, but the process is nearly identical:
- Open the Snapchat app and go to the Chats screen by swiping right.
- Find the pinned chat you want to unpin, identified by the pin icon or a marked status.
- Long-press the pinned chat to open the contextual options. If long-press doesn’t work, you can try tapping and holding briefly to trigger the menu.
- Choose Unpin Chat from the options. In some Android skins, you might see Unpin from Top or simply Unpin.
- The chat will move back to the standard list, influenced by the latest message timestamp.
What if you can’t unpin a Snapchat chat?
Occasionally, users report trouble unpinning a chat. Here are common fixes and considerations:
- Ensure you’re signed into the correct account. Pins are saved per account, so signing out and back in can help in some cases.
- Update Snapchat to the latest version. Some older builds may have quirks related to pin management.
- Test with a different chat. If you can unpin one chat but not another, there might be a temporary UI issue with that specific thread.
- Restart the device. A simple reboot can clear minor glitches.

Common questions about unpinning on Snapchat
- Can I unpin multiple chats at once?
- Snapchat typically requires unpinning one chat at a time through the context menu. You can repeat the steps for each pinned chat.
- Will unpinning affect my chat order permanently?
- Unpinning returns the chat to its normal position based on activity, but you can pin it again later if needed.
- Do pins transfer across devices?
- Yes, pins are tied to your account. If you use Snapchat on another device with the same account, your pinned chats should appear there as well, subject to app version and synchronization.
